    <command:examples>
      <command:example>
        <maml:title>Example 1</maml:title>
        <dev:code>PS C:\&gt; New-UDChart -Type Bar -Title "Memory" -Endpoint {
    Get-Process -Name chrome | Out-UDChartData -LabelProperty "Id" -Dataset @(
        New-UDChartDataset -DataProperty "WorkingSet" -Label "Working Set" -BackgroundColor "rgb(63,123,3)"
        New-UDChartDataset -DataProperty "PeakWorkingSet" -Label "Peak Working Set" -BackgroundColor "rgb(134,342,122)"
        New-UDChartDataset -DataProperty "VirtualMemorySize" -Label "Virtual Memory Size" -BackgroundColor "rgb(234,33,43)"
    )
}</dev:code>
        <dev:remarks>
          <maml:para>Creates a chart with different datasets of different types of memory usage.</maml:para>
        </dev:remarks>
      </command:example>
    </command:examples>

    <command:examples>
      <command:example>
        <maml:title>Example 1</maml:title>
        <dev:code>PS C:\&gt; New-UDChart -Type Line -Title "CPU" -Endpoint {
    Get-Process -Name chrome | Out-UDChartData -LabelProperty "Id" -DataProperty "CPU"
}</dev:code>
        <dev:remarks>
          <maml:para>Outputs data from Get-Process and selects the Id as the label (x-axis) and the CPU as the data (y-axis).</maml:para>
        </dev:remarks>
      </command:example>
      <command:example>
        <maml:title>Example 2</maml:title>
        <dev:code>PS C:\&gt; New-UDChart -Type Bar -Title "Memory" -Endpoint {
    Get-Process -Name chrome | Out-UDChartData -LabelProperty "Id" -Dataset @(
        New-UDChartDataset -DataProperty "WorkingSet" -Label "Working Set" -BackgroundColor "rgb(63,123,3)"
        New-UDChartDataset -DataProperty "PeakWorkingSet" -Label "Peak Working Set" -BackgroundColor "rgb(134,342,122)"
        New-UDChartDataset -DataProperty "VirtualMemorySize" -Label "Virtual Memory Size" -BackgroundColor "rgb(234,33,43)"
    )
}</dev:code>
        <dev:remarks>
          <maml:para>Outputs data from Get-Process and selects WorkingSet, PeakWorkingSet and VritualMemorySize as data sets from the output.</maml:para>
        </dev:remarks>
      </command:example>
    </command:examples>

    <command:examples>
      <command:example>
        <maml:title>Example 1</maml:title>
        <dev:code>PS C:\&gt; New-UDMonitor -Type Line -Title "Available Memory" -RefreshInterval 1 -DataPointHistory 100 -Endpoint {
    Get-Counter '\Memory\Available MBytes' | Select-Object -ExpandProperty CounterSamples | Select -ExpandProperty CookedValue | Out-UDMonitorData
}</dev:code>
        <dev:remarks>
          <maml:para>Outputs the available memory on the current machine.</maml:para>
        </dev:remarks>
      </command:example>
    </command:examples>
